Franz Park, St. Louis, MO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Franz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Franz Park Studio Apartments | $1,375 | $700 | $2,075 |
| Franz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,592 | $720 | $3,300 |
| Franz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,028 | $975 | $5,320 |
| Franz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,104 | $1,500 | $6,481 |
| Franz Park 4 Bedroom Apartments | $7,193 | $7,193 | $7,193 |
